1. The Rise of Grazing Tables

One of the hottest dinner party food trends this season is the grazing table. Gone are the days of traditional plated meals or buffets—grazing tables are here to stay. These large, spread-out tables are designed to allow guests to help themselves, sampling an array of delicious bites. From artisanal cheeses and charcuterie to roasted vegetables and fresh fruits, grazing tables are a beautiful and interactive way to showcase a variety of flavors and textures.

What makes grazing tables so appealing is their versatility. You can customize the spread to reflect the theme of your party, incorporating elements that are both seasonal and culturally relevant. Think of a Mediterranean grazing table with hummus, olives, and flatbreads, or a summer-themed one featuring fresh seafood and tangy dips. Not only does this trend cater to different tastes, but it also creates a relaxed and social atmosphere—perfect for mingling and casual conversation.

2. Plant-Based and Vegan Options Are a Must

In today’s world, plant-based dining is no longer just a trend—it’s a lifestyle. More and more people are looking for essential party menu ideas that include plant-based options. Whether your guests are vegan, vegetarian, or simply looking to eat more mindfully, offering plant-based alternatives at your dinner party is an absolute must.

This doesn’t mean you need to serve a bland plate of tofu and salad. Get creative! Vegan dishes like creamy avocado pasta, hearty vegetable curries, or plant-based sliders can easily take center stage at your event. The key is to create dishes that are packed with flavor and texture—think smoky roasted cauliflower, coconut milk risotto, or a mushroom Wellington that rivals any traditional meat-based dish.

What’s exciting is that plant-based dining has evolved beyond just meat substitutes. It’s about exploring bold flavors, seasonal vegetables, and innovative cooking techniques that show guests how diverse and delicious plant-based meals can be. 3. Bold and Unconventional Flavor Pairings

If you want to truly wow your guests, consider embracing bold and unconventional flavor pairings. Combining unexpected ingredients can elevate your menu and make each dish memorable. For instance, think of pairing sweet and savory—such as figs with prosciutto, or balsamic strawberries on a charcuterie board. Alternatively, explore the fusion of global cuisines, like Korean BBQ tacos or sushi with a Mexican twist.

This year, a lot of attention is being placed on incorporating more global flavors into dinner parties. Middle Eastern spices, Asian-inspired sauces, and Latin American herbs are all the rage, bringing fresh, vibrant flavors to the table. Try serving a Moroccan spiced lamb tagine with couscous or a Thai green curry with coconut rice to introduce an exotic flair to your menu.

These combinations are not only intriguing but also provide a delightful burst of flavors that will leave your guests pleasantly surprised. 4. Small Plates and Interactive Dining Experiences

Another trend that’s taking over dinner parties is the shift toward small plates and interactive dining. Sharing meals has always been an important part of human connection, and now that ethos is reflected in the way we entertain. Small plates allow guests to sample a variety of dishes without feeling overwhelmed by a large, heavy meal.

Think tapas-style plates or mini versions of your favorite comfort foods—everything from sliders to sushi rolls, and bite-sized desserts to gourmet bruschetta. These small dishes encourage conversation and allow guests to try a little bit of everything. Pair this with wine or cocktail pairings for each dish, and you’ll create an immersive, delightful experience.

For those looking to level up their dinner party, consider setting up interactive stations where guests can assemble their own dishes. A taco bar, sushi-rolling station, or build-your-own bruschetta set-up can all become engaging focal points. Not only does this give guests the chance to be creative, but it also allows them to customize their food to suit their personal tastes.

6. Delectable Desserts with a Twist

Finally, no dinner party is complete without dessert, and this year, the dessert table is taking a decidedly modern turn. While classic desserts like cakes and pastries are always a hit, the real showstoppers are the inventive and surprising desserts. Think deconstructed tiramisu, churro bowls with chocolate mousse, or panna cotta served in delicate jars.

For an even more unique experience, why not turn dessert into a multi-sensory journey? Dessert-themed cocktails, edible desserts that incorporate unexpected textures, or even interactive elements (like guests decorating their own mini cakes) can all make the last course of the evening just as memorable as the first.
